Generally stated, destination is the idea that a resource or "object of social wealth" has or has been given a specific purpose, goal, or duty, or is otherwise meant to be used in a certain way or as part of another resource. In its formal manifestations, destination helps determine legal classifications and legal outcomes in certain instances : moveable or immoveable, for example. 1, record 1, English, - destination
Record number: 1, Textual support number: 1 OBS
Not to be confused with the term appropriation, which refers to the end given to a thing, whereas the term destination refers to the specific use of that thing. 2, record 1, English, - destination

Under the Ontario [LEGAL AID] plan, duty counsel are appointed to interview persons in custody or who are summoned to appear on a criminal charge, prior to their appearance before a magistrate and who wish legal aid. The primary function of duty counsel is to advise the defendant with respect to his legal rights, to advise him as to the elements of the offence with which he is charged, and to represent him on an application for bail or an adjournment. 2, record 4, English, - duty%20counsel

The Court also distinguished between the legal right of redemption in foreclosure proceedings and a borrower's contractual right to reinstate a defaulted loan. By law, a defaulting borrower in foreclosure is entitled to redeem his or her property by paying the entire principal and interest due before confirmation of the sheriff's sale. When that happens, the lender has a legal duty to dismiss the foreclosure proceedings and may not condition that dismissal on payment of attorney fees. This differs from a contractual right to reinstate a loan. In that instance, the borrower typically pays only the amounts needed to make the loan current and continues all future payments on the previously agreed-upon schedule. 3, record 18, English, - legal%20right%20of%20redemption

The duty to obtain informed consent requires all physicians to fully inform patients of any material risks involved in treatment, and answer patients’ questions regarding such risks. Physicans cannot discharge this obligation without being able to effectively communicate with their patients. 3, record 29, English, - duty%20to%20obtain%20informed%20consent

Duties may be non-legal(moral, natural, religious, or other) or legal... but not all moral or natural duties are also legal, e. g. not to be ungrateful or uncharitable.... Conversely many legal duties arise in circumstances where there is no moral duty or go beyond moral duty. But the existence of moral duty has been a powerful factor in influencing systems of law to recognize a legal duty, e. g. to avoid injury to one who obviously might be injured by failure to take care, or to seek to rescue persons in trouble. 2, record 37, English, - moral%20duty

Every one is under a legal duty(a) as a parent, foster parent, guardian or head of a family, to provide necessaries of life for a child under the age of sixteen years;(b) to provide necessaries of life to their spouse or common-law partner; and(c) to provide necessaries of life to a person under his charge if that person(i) is unable, by reason of detention, age, illness, mental disorder or other cause, to withdraw himself from that charge, and(ii) is unable to provide himself with necessaries of life. 2, record 40, English, - duty%20to%20provide%20the%20necessaries%20of%20life

The duty of confidentiality... Physicians are legally(and ethically) bound to hold any and all information obtained from a patient confidential. This duty ensures that the patient's legal rights(including reputation and social status) are protected. Confidentiality is, of course, also recognized as essential for physician-patient respect and trust. Exceptions arise when the patient waives the right to confidentiality or when provided for in law. 4, record 44, English, - duty%20of%20confidentiality

It is sometimes asserted that a state may exist even though it has no territory, and in this connection instances of the governments in exile during the World War II are cited. This, however, is not a true illustration because the cases of the governments in exile are merely examples of lawful governments functioning from another country during continuance of military operations. The dispossession of the lawful government by the invader pendente bello is no more than an incident of military operations. 2, record 55, English, - legal%20government
